Indiana firm buys 2 plants from Dana

BLADE STAFF

SOUTH BEND, Ind.-- An Indiana company has purchased two manufacturing facilities from Maumee-based Dana Holding Corp. for an undisclosed price.

Schaefer Gear Works Inc. has acquired the plants in Fredericktown, Ohio, and Blacklick, Ohio. Both are in the central part of the state and have a combined 158 salaried and hourly employees. Schaefer indicated that it would keep the employees.

The plants make axles and diferentials for leisure, all-terrain, and utility vehicles.
